Let me start with the basic necessity, sports bra. I got both of them from Forever 21. I have been using Forever 21 sports bras forever and I like the quality and how comfortable they are. Each bra was $10. And this is what I love about Forever 21, you can get such great variety at such reasonable prices. 

This is my first yellow bra and I got it because I like my active-wear to be in fun colors. The back is interesting and is perfect for the strappy racer-back tank tops. 


This is a simple racer-back one. The back has a mesh kind of detail, which looks really cool. I love this bright girly color. 


Moving on to tank tops. I like tanks as opposed to tops with sleeves as they make me less sweaty. 

I picked up this orange tank from Forever 21 for $10. It is not very form-fitting and is very comfortable. It is soft and light and so bright! I am not a fan of colors like orange and yellow but I decided to change things up a little bit this time around. 


This plain black tank is by Danskin from Walmart. I was just walking past the active-wear section when I happened to spot this. It was just $4 and I thought it was a steal. It is super soft and light and comfortable. I loved the way it fit me. 


This tank is from TJ Maxx. I got it for $9. This one is slightly more fitted and thicker. But it really looks smart and I love the red and black combo.


This tank is from Walmart and it was $12. I love the double strap look. It has an in-built bra, so I can skip wearing a sports bra with this. This is one of my favorite shirts. 


Now the leggings. I like capri style leggings and need part of my legs to breathe in the open air. I am not the shorts kind of mommy. Not yet, at least. May be when I have a more toned body I can make the switch. 

This black animal print legging is from TJ Maxx and was $20. It is by Calvin Klein and it is so comfortable to workout in. It has a little mesh detail at the calves, adding to the cool quotient. 


The next 2 leggings are from Forever 21. They are $20 each. This legging is dual colored - it has gray in front and black at the back. I love the thick band at the waist, it prevent the legging from slipping during workouts. It also tucks the mommy pouch in!  


This one is plain black with the pink detailing in front. It is slightly shorter than the other 2 leggings and I love it. It is really light weight and flatters my body type. All the 3 leggings I got have hidden pockets, but honestly, I don't know what to hide in them!
